Home Glass Repairs: A Comprehensive Guide
When it pertains to preserving the aesthetic and functional stability of a home, glass plays an essential role. From doors and windows to mirrors and shower enclosures, glass improves natural light, supplies views, and adds to the general ambiance of a space. Nevertheless, it can be susceptible to damage, whether from weather condition conditions, unexpected effects, or wear and tear with time. This guide will provide house owners with an informative overview of home glass repairs, suggestions on when to call a professional, and answers to often asked questions.
Understanding Common Types of Glass Damage
Before delving into repair services, it's necessary to acknowledge the common kinds of glass damage that property owners may come across. Below is a table highlighting these types of damage and their potential causes.

When confronted with glass damage, the initial step is to evaluate the level of the issue. Visual examination will assist determine whether the damage is superficial or requires more substantial intervention. Here's a basic list homeowners can use:
Inspect the Area: Identify cracks, chips, or other noticeable signs of damage.Inspect Functionality: Ensure doors and windows open and close smoothly without obstruction.Try to find Drafts: Feel for cold air coming through windows, suggesting possible seal failure.Evaluate Safety: Determine if the damage poses a safety danger, especially with broken or shattered glass.Fixing Glass: When to DIY vs. Call a Professional

Fixing Minor Chips and Cracks
Among the most uncomplicated repairs is addressing small chips and cracks, generally using a glass repair resin. Here's how to do it:
Clean the Area: Use a glass cleaner to ensure the surface area is complimentary from dirt and wetness.Apply Repair Resin: Following the maker's directions, use the resin to the damaged area using a syringe or applicator.Treat the Resin: Allow the resin to cure as directed, often needing direct exposure to sunshine or UV light.Sand Smooth: Once treated, sand the location to develop a smooth finish.2. Changing Broken Glass Panes
For considerable damage, changing the entire glass pane might be needed. The steps typically include:
Measure the Opening: Accurately determine the dimensions of the existing frame.Order Replacement Glass: Purchase brand-new glass cut to size from a local provider.Get Rid Of Broken Glass: Carefully eliminate the old glass, utilizing gloves and safety goggles for defense.Install New Glass: Place the brand-new pane into the frame, securing it with glazing points.Seal and Finish: Use caulk to seal any gaps and make sure a weather-tight surface.3. Bring Back Foggy Windows
Foggy windows suggest seal failure in double-pane windows, which frequently needs replacement. Nevertheless, some short-term options exist:

Q3: How do I understand if I require to replace my windows?
A3: If your windows exhibit considerable fractures, consistent fogging, or air leaks, it may be time to change them for much better energy efficiency and visual appeals.
Q4: What are the signs of seal failure in windows?
A4: Common indications include condensation between panes, foggy glass, and noticeable wetness accumulation, which show that the seal is compromised.
